To solve for x, we need to isolate x on one side of the equation. Here's the step-by-step solution:
3x + 7 = 22
Subtract 7 from both sides:
3x = 22 - 7
3x = 15
Divide both sides by 3:
x = 15 / 3
x = 5
Therefore, the value of x is 5.
